Output ec3ebf68e6989495b9101f82923c8ef80c67e24bab210747308a0778b68434ca:1

value
54292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bb27bbedc8d832c2b3c21e7c0ce31114732a1e4 OP_EQUALVERIFY OP_CHECKSIG
address
1Ka3zBgz9bEu19hJB39gR92aazTEA1Vpgf
transaction
ec3ebf68e6989495b9101f82923c8ef80c67e24bab210747308a0778b68434ca
confirmations
547219
spent
true